Manchenahalli
Manchenahalli is a village located in Gauribidanur taluka of Chikkaballapura district in Karnataka, India. It is situated 16km away from sub-district headquarter Gauribidanur (tehsildar office) and 19km away from district headquarter Chikkaballapur. As per 2009 stats, Manchenahalli village is also a gram panchayat.

About Manchenahalli
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Manchenahalli is 623411. The village spans a total geographical area of 663.53 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 561211. Gauribidanur is nearest town to Manchenahalli village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 16km away.
When it comes to local governance, Manchenahalli village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Chikkaballapur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Chikkballapur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Manchenahalli
According to the 2011 Census, Manchenahalli has a total population of about 7,775, with approximately 3,948 males and 3,827 females. The sex ratio is around 969 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 814 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 1,493 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 588. The overall literacy rate is approximately 65.79%, with male literacy at about 70.47% and female literacy near 60.96%. There are around 1,842 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 7,775 | 3,948 | 3,827 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 814 | 427 | 387 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 1,493 | 772 | 721 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 588 | 286 | 302 |
Literate Population | 5,115 | 2,782 | 2,333 |
Illiterate Population | 2,660 | 1,166 | 1,494 |
Connectivity of Manchenahalli
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Manchenahalli. As per the 2011 stats, Manchenahalli had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
